Skillet-Based Deconstructed Pepper Delight

Envision a classic stuffed bell pepper deconstructed and served right from the skillet, loaded with sauteed bell peppers, juicy beef, and covered with a golden layer of cheddar cheese. This skillet-based delightful recipe gives you all the flavors of a traditional stuffed pepper in half the time.

Directions
6 STEPS
10 min
PREP TIME
19 min
COOK TIME
29 min
TOTAL TIME
1
Place a large skillet over medium-high heat.
2
Add the ground beef, finely chopped yellow onion, 1 inch chopped green bell pepper, minced garlic, and salt to the skillet. Cook for around 7 minutes or until the beef is no longer pink, and the vegetables are tender. Make sure to stir occasionally during the process.
3
Add the chopped Roma tomatoes, dried basil, dried oregano, and garlic powder to the mix. Stir well to combine everything.
4
Then add the uncooked instant white rice and water, stirring once again to ensure all the ingredients are well mixed.
5
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at, cover the skillet, and let it simmer for around 10 minutes or until the rice is tender.
6
Remove the skillet from heat. Sprinkle the grated mild cheddar cheese evenly over the top. Cover the skillet and let it stand for about 2 minutes, or until the cheese melts and becomes nicely golden.
